The character 冈, with its traditional form 岡, originally depicted a geographical feature. Its traditional form incorporates the mountain radical 山 (shān), directly linking it to elevated terrain. The simplified modern form, 冈, consists of the enclosing framework 冂 (jiōng) surrounding the element 㐅 (wǔ). It denotes a low ridge, a small hill, or the spine of a mountain range, focusing on undulating land rather than towering peaks. Over time, its meaning has remained tied to topography, commonly appearing in place names for hills and ridges as a descriptor of rolling landscapes.
